Re: [LegacyUG] Ref: Tagging
First go to the first person in the future group, then View (on the toolbar), then Focus group. There are 8 tabs which you can add into the future group. Near the bottom you can switch to a different person to start from. For example make the first choice Mary Smith; all her ancestors, then Mary's descendants, lastly her mother inlaw (only). When you have named and saved, you can attach any tag number to all at once. Re: [LegacyUG] Ref: Tagging
On 2010/01/13 20:29, Ila Johnson set forth the following: I want to know how to tag certain people in my database I need to do additional work on. I have a very large database (over 40,000) and as I am working with the families find information on them I add to the notes section. I want to know how I can tag these people so I can go back and add the information I have put into their notes more easily. Do I list their names after tag descriptions? Help does not full explain how to mark individuals. If I add a tag it turns blue for everyone not just for him? I don't understand why you're having a problem! To me, it's a very simple matter of, as I enter the data in the Notes, to click one of 3 displayed tags. Before you start, decide which tag you're going to use and give it a meaningful description. Each individual that you enter data in the Notes for should have the same tag set. Later on, I can then create a list of all those individuals that have that tag set. Using the list, I can then work through them one at a time, and when finished, click on the tag again to remove it, thus taking them off the list. Have you read up on the Advanced Tagging window? Right-click on one of the 3 tags displayed on an individual and you'll see the options.
